You know when our Lord and Savior Jesus Christ utter these words: "My God my God why hast thou forsaken me? (Matthew 27:46) as he cried out from beneath the weight of our sins he quaked in His spirit, and for a moment our sins had separated Him from the Father. One thing we learn from this and that is Jesus Christ was fully human when He walked upon the Earth, and I am not stopping there he was also fully God. So he laid down His life that we may live eternally, so is it any Wonder when we get shaken in our spirit so strongly that we to feel, like we've been separated from God ourselves; if our Lord God's Son said why have you forsaken me, think it not strange if we find ourselves saying the same thing.
